| HI, I noticed on sat that the price of the D300 is coming down already Jessops were selling them for £1099 retail price £1299, also you can buy D200 for £749 this is a great price for this great camera. As far as housings go most of the housing manufacturers can not keep up with the bodies on sale now with out all the new ones coming out. I had a five month wait for my D200 Seacam housing. Dates for new housings (new bodies) are months away & I would say that Ikelite will be one if not the first to bring them out. Andy |

Just because a housing has been announced doesn't mean it's AVAILABLE. Ocean Optics in the UK hasn't got them yet. If the housings aren't in the hands of divers then how can anyone comment on their ability underwater?? Just click on "Sample Images" from Digideep and you'll get my point; "We did not receive any underwater images for this product, yet." Unless I've missed something on Digideep, Wetpixel, etc etc, no one has taken one underwater yet. Rob |
